Eric McCann Most likely you are talking about the 1215A which used a single 421-8H woofer. Altec is out of buisiness, sometimes you can find these cabs on Ebay! You might check with Great Plains Audio, in Oklahoma, they are a company of former Altec employees and they might be able to help you out!
